The Role
As Lead Manufacturing Engineer, you will take ownership of manufacturing development activities from early concept through to prototype and low-volume production. Working within a highly collaborative engineering environment, you will help define manufacturing strategy, assembly processes, tooling and automation solutions for first-generation products. This role would suit someone who thrives in hands-on engineering environments, and is motivated by building processes and systems from the ground up rather than optimising mature production lines.
Key responsibilities will include:
- Developing manufacturing and assembly processes for advanced electronic products
- Supporting the transition from R&D prototype builds into commercial-ready production
- Designing and implementing low-volume automation and robotic assembly solutions
- Working closely with design engineers on Design for Manufacture and Design for Assembly
- Evaluating manufacturing methods including adhesives, sealing technologies, tooling and precision assembly techniques
- Supporting product validation, testing and certification activities
- Working with external suppliers and manufacturing partners including PCB/PCBA suppliers and precision engineering companies
- Establishing manufacturing documentation, quality processes and scalable production methodologies
- Supporting longer-term manufacturing scale-up strategy as the company grows
